Output 323ffe5377625201818454197ce90cce97d3a990ad33d224b3492942899a7ac2:1

value
3643134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a95eb3a4efc437268f17a832b404405906270ed OP_EQUAL
address
347b65Nk3KJ9PdHqMkt8SBozyzNB3KsqcW
transaction
323ffe5377625201818454197ce90cce97d3a990ad33d224b3492942899a7ac2
spent
true